#1936d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1936dd is composed of 9.8% red, 21.2%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 75.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 48.2%. #1936dd color hex could be obtained by blending #326cff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#1936d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020a is the darkest color, while #f7f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1936d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78797e is the less saturated color, while #0629f0 is the most saturated one.
